Use HDD over PCMCIA Alfadata CD1200 ?

Is it possible?

Tis is the one:
Alfadata CD1200

I have master/slave cable on it. Could HDD be added as slave on that channel?

I would use it as some sort of HDD software source, not as primary HDD.

Thanks

The information on that link does not make it clear whether it is the Alfa Data CD1200 controller which can be used with standard ATAPI CD-ROM drives or the Tandem unit.

If it is the Alfa Data, then it's still not clear whether it would support devices configured as Master and Slave. Even if is compatible with two devices (and you must use the drivers in the IDE-Fix package in that event), then you've still got the problem of writing a mountlist to access the hard drive.

If it is the Tandem, then it is best not to give it a try in case the interface is not compatible with IDE/ATAPI devices.

I tried to connect HDD as slave on cable, nothing. (checked with HDToolbox)

Then I tried to connect another CDROM, and opened HDToolbox, ten tandemat_pcmcia.device

It founds two devices on address 0 and 1, but only the master loads CD once it is inserted. I tried on second one without success.

When you read history about Parralel ATA we can conclude that this device was not made for HDDs, most probably.

However, it works OK with LG CD rewritable (by all means newer then Mitsumi drives which it was designed for).
